Vickie is also a musician and composer. She has been writing music since she was 13 years old. Her music has been recorded by the Westminster College Women's Choir and local LDS artists.

I was always writing plays as a child, and my mother would clear out the basement so the neighborhood kids could perform my "works of art". In high school I was encouraged by my English teacher, Mrs. Harvey, who once asked of me, "Have you ever thought of becoming a writer?" Well, I wrote my first "novel" at age seventeen, a sappy love story between a beach bum and a rich girl. Ah, to be seventeen again. But from that first attempt I have never looked back, working to improve my skills and voice as a writer. Perseverance is not always easy to maintain in life, especially when it comes to writing, but when you love something as much as I love writing it becomes a necessity of life. I hope my readers will experience my passion for the written word, my faith, my optimism, and general belief that we can overcome adversity in this life and know true happiness.
I am a native of Utah but have also lived in Montana, Nebraska, Idaho, and Colorado. I love to go camping with my family, I enjoy travel and have a great love of history.
